A Turning Point for Darfur: Janjaweed Leader Found Guilty
A significant step toward accountability has been taken in the long-standing conflict in Sudan’s Darfur region. The International Criminal court (ICC) on Monday convicted Ali Muhammad Ali Abd-Al-Rahman, a leader of the notorious janjaweed militia, of war crimes and crimes against humanity. This conviction marks the first ICC trial focused on crimes committed in Darfur as the case was referred by the U.N. Security Council in 2005.
The charges against Abd-Al-Rahman include executions, rape, and torture - reflecting the horrific scale of violence inflicted upon civilians.United Nations human rights chief Volker Türk hailed the verdict as a crucial acknowledgment of the suffering endured by victims and a first step toward long-delayed justice.
However, the defense team continues to claim mistaken identity, asserting Abd-Al-Rahman is not the individual sought by the court. Sentencing will be steadfast at a later date.
understanding the Context:
* The conflict in Darfur began in 2003, sparked by clashes between non-Arab rebels and the Sudanese government.
* The government responded by mobilizing the janjaweed, Arab militias accused of widespread atrocities.
* Many rights groups and governments have characterized the ensuing violence as genocide.
* Sudan is currently embroiled in a devastating civil war, creating what the U.N. describes as the world’s worst humanitarian crisis, triggering mass displacement.
This latest conviction arrives as Sudan faces renewed instability, underscoring the urgent need for lasting peace and accountability.
nobel Prize in Physics Awarded for Quantum Tunneling Breakthroughs
Across the globe, the Nobel Prize in Physics was announced on Tuesday, recognizing three U.S.-based scientists for their work on quantum tunneling. This essential phenomenon,predicted by quantum mechanics,explains how particles can pass through barriers they classically shouldn’t be able to overcome.
The laureates’ research has profoundly impacted technologies you use daily, including cellphones, MRIs, and computer chips. Olle Eriksson, chair of the Nobel Committee for physics, emphasized the enduring relevance of this century-old quantum mechanics, noting its continued ability to yield new discoveries.
What is Quantum Tunneling?
* It’s a quantum mechanical effect where particles penetrate energy barriers.
* This principle is essential for the operation of many modern technologies.
* The Nobel Prize recognizes the theoretical foundations and experimental verification of this phenomenon.
